The Spanish writer David Zaplana is originally from Cartagena, although he grew up in another town in Murcia, Aljorra.
He studied Telecommunications Engineering in Valencia and founded an audiovisual production company, Ala Deriva, in 2006 with Ana Ballabriga, his partner and with whom he writes his novels.
In 2007, they published their first book, Tras el sol de Cartagena, which was followed by other titles such as La paradoja del bibliotecario ciego and La profecía del desierto. They combine writing fiction books with scripts for short films and television series and have received several awards for their audiovisual work.
In addition to his books written in collaboration with Ballabriga, the Murcian writer is also known for his short stories and was the winner of the IV Erotic Short Story Contest of the Cartagena City Council.
